I have been fortunate enough to hunt ranches with an established age structure for many years. This gives you the advantage of seeing and watching bucks of all ages in front of you at the same time on the same hunt. It also allows you to follow the characteristics of a particular buck throughout his life to 6, 7 or even older sometimes.
If I did not have this experience and most of my sightings were of 3 year old bucks and younger, I think it would be real hard for me to age a buck to be 5 or 6. Aging on the hoof is never going to be a science, its a best guess but the more that we study and practice the better we can get. There is still no substitute for watching a deer grow up and get old. |
